aaronng
27-03-2007, 08:36 PM
whats better... tune stock ecu with vafcII

or tunable aftermarket ecu?

value for money and power?

VAFCII cannot alter ignition timing. It can only alter fuel maps and vtec point.

Aftermarket ECU or even a product like the S100 can alter ignition timing as well.

aaronng
29-03-2007, 05:41 PM
So The NEO is better - as is a bit MORE tunable? - YES???

No, Neo is the same as VAFCII, but it supposedly cannot alter the VTEC point for i-VTEC engines. But the Neo has a graphical interface, while the VAFCII has just text. So in terms of tunability, the Neo is worse than VAFCII for i-VTEC engines, but are the same for your CRX.

Which one is better?

IMO, for most Vtec Honda's - the VAFC II

Fuel & Vtec are directly adjustable.
The tuner needs to be aware that timing is also affected as the MAP senor output is the tuning key.
